Today was a day I look forward to all year long. It was the annual
Unused Fabric and Crafts Sale with all the proceeds going to charity. I stumbled upon this sale within months of moving to this city and this marks my third time attending.
Knowing what to expect and having a game plan in mind, this year I braved being amongst the crowd that gathered waiting for the doors to the sale to open. Ready to see some sewing treasures?

Finally, here's where I went a bit crazy in the notion section. Want to guess how many zippers are in the basket? As I mentioned, everything was pre-bundled this year - including zippers. The past couple of years you could sort through them individually, which I really liked. This year the zippers were sealed into baggies with 10 zips to a bag and the colours were mixed. Knowing that zippers are one notion I use quite a lot of, I tried to find baggies that had some basic coloured zips. The price is so fantastic for zips that it wasn't until I got home that I counted up all the baggies of zippers I had stuffed into my shopping bag. Would you believe that I grabbed 13!? Yeah, so that means I just added 130 assorted zippers to my stash in one go, for the grand sum of $13. Now you know one of the reasons I look forward to this sale each year.
